Reducing Power Consumption While Maximizing Lifespan

One of the most compelling arguments for LED headlight bulbs is their remarkable energy efficiency. Older lighting technologies consume significant amounts of energy as thermal output, while LED variants convert more than four-fifths of power usage into illumination. This dramatic reduction in energy demand doesn’t just lowers vehicle fuel consumption but also extends battery life in electric or hybrid cars.

Furthermore, the durability of LED headlight bulbs exceeds conventional alternatives by a wide margin. Although incandescent units last for around six months to a year, LED versions are designed to perform for as long as a decade under normal conditions. This longevity results in less frequent maintenance, saving drivers time and financial resources in the years ahead.

Performance in Extreme Temperatures

A frequently ignored benefit of LED headlight bulbs is their ability to perform flawlessly in intense heat or cold. Traditional halogen bulbs struggle in scorching climates, becoming too hot and dimming, while freezing conditions may lead to damage or failure. In contrast, LED headlight bulbs thrive in such extremes, maintaining peak luminosity without sacrifice.

This resilience stems from their efficient thermal management mechanisms, which redirect excess heat away from critical components. Even amidst extended operation, they stay cool to the touch, avoiding heat-related degradation and ensuring long-lasting performance. For motorists residing in areas experiencing harsh climates, this trait is indispensable.
